Samoa - Import of Penicillins or Streptomycins in Dosage Forms
Since 2014, Samoa Import of Penicillins or Streptomycins in Dosage Forms was down by 15.5% year on year. At $36,341.5 in 2019, the country was ranked number 150 comparing other countries in Import of Penicillins or Streptomycins in Dosage Forms. Samoa is overtaken by East Timor, which was number 149 at $38,188.81 and is followed by Dominican Republic at $33,728.61. United States topped the ranking with $612,783,476 in 2019, an increase of 8.3% compared to 2018. Saudi Arabia, China and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Namibia witnessed the best average annual growth at +291.7% per year, while Algeria recorded the worst performance at -57.7% per year.
